More prison likely for 'Beast of Blenheim' - ex-detective

From Morning Report, 7:29 am on 17 October 2018

The detective who led the original investigation into serial rapist Stewart Murray Wilson says the 71-year-old should never again be let out of jail. Wilson, dubbed the Beast of Blenheim, was jailed for 21 years in 1996 for for a multitude of violent sexual attacks on women and girls. He was freed on parole under strict supervision but is expected to be back behind bars after being found guilty yesterday of a further 11 historical charges including rape and attempted rape - one of the victims was aged just nine. Retired detective Colin Mackay led the Blenheim investigation in the 1990s.
